Your Impact:
Based at our Smeaton Grange facility and reporting to the Production and Continuous Improvement Manager, you will play a key role in operating and maintaining equipment to ensure smooth production. With safety and quality as your top priorities, you’ll help us deliver premium products while minimising waste and keeping operations efficient.
As a hands-on team player, you’ll thrive in our small-site environment, where flexibility, reliability, and collaboration are essential.
You’ll be working on a rotating shift roster:
- Week 1: 5:00am – 1:06pm
- Week 2: 10:30am – 6:36pm
This role also includes some Saturday shifts, paid at overtime rates.
More specifically, you will be involved in:
- Setting up machinery in line with the daily production plan
- Safely operating processing lines and related equipment
- Identifying and reporting hazards, near misses, and incidents
- Troubleshooting issues: clearing jams, resolving faults, and responding to breakdowns
- Ensuring incoming materials meet required specifications
- Verifying that finished products meet quality standards
- Accurately reading and recording batch and production information
- Supporting general cleaning of the facility and equipment
You may also assist with other duties such as debagging, filling, processing, case packing, dispatch, and more — depending on the day’s needs.
